         <title>Theseus</title>
         <author>sophia30035530</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/sophia30035530/ze6cpx9kdwe52duc/wish/2908423875</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>The brave Athens duke, engaged to Hippolyta. Throughout the play, Theseus stands for authority and law. He only makes an appearance at the start and finish of the narrative, staying out of the forest's dreamlike happenings.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Oberon</title>
         <author>sophia30035530</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/sophia30035530/ze6cpx9kdwe52duc/wish/2908427616</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Oberon, the king of the fairies, is first at conflict with Titania, his wife. Oberon's desire for vengeance on Titania prompts him to send Puck to retrieve the love-potion flower, which causes so much of the play's turmoil and farce.</p><p><br/></p>]]></description>
